Cocktails for Independence Day: feat. Kyle Wilkinson, Beaufort Bar at The Savoy

The last in our series of cocktails for 4th of July Independence Day celebrations is quite the adventurer. Forget your average barrel-aged cocktail left to do its stuff quietly behind the bar, this one has seen more of the world than most of us experience in a lifetime. If only barrels could talk, we’re betting it would have some tales to tell. Get this: this cocktail has spent the last five months travelling around the world on a Cunard Cruise Liner.

Apart from a great story that means the cocktail has experienced different climates and humidity which makes it kinda special in our books. “It’s actually a team drink led by Neil Donachie,” says Head Bartender Kyle Wilkinson. “It’s based around all the ingredients that were discovered in the New World, otherwise there would have been no Independence Day at all.” He has a point.

The über barrel-aged cocktail came back from its travels three weeks ago and is currently being bottled in Scotland. It will be making its debut in the Beaufort Bar in a few weeks time but for the 4th July celebrations, you can try the no less spectacular un-aged version. Just make sure you go back to try its older sibling in a few weeks time.

Which whiskey did you choose for your Independence Day Cocktail?

We went for Jack Daniel’s Single Barrel – it’s rather special, just like this cocktail.

What independent touch have you added to the drink?

Other than sending it on a voyage on a cruise ship? I’d say the choice of ingredients which have been chosen to reflect the ingredients discovered at the dawn of the New World. The way we serve it is very different too; it comes in a magnifying glass that sits on top of a map so you can trace its journey.

The Beaufort Bar’s Independence Day cocktail:
Age of Discovery

40ml Jack Daniel’s Single Barrel
20ml Bacardí 8 Year Old
20ml homemade spiced Madeira
10ml Martini Rubino
10ml Dubonnet
2 dashes Angostura aromatic bitters
2 dashes Angostura Orange Bitters

Method:
Stir ingredients over ice and rest in a barrel. Serve in a Rocks glass over ice (the aged version will be served straight from the freezer).
